Good to know
Small rocky beach, not sandy
Reviewers describe a small beach with rocks rather than sand, better suited for short visits than full beach days.
Viewpoint accessible to most
The first rope section leads to benches where visitors can enjoy views without attempting the full descent to the beach.
Experienced climbers only
Access requires descending two rope sections; people without mountaineering experience should not attempt the full beach.
Avoid with children or pets
The rocky terrain, hidden sharp rocks in water, and dangerous access make this unsuitable for young children or animals.
